首先,让我们来看一下unzip命令的基本用法:
```
unzip [选项] 压缩文件.zip
```
在上面的命令中,我们需要将压缩文件的名称替换为实际的压缩文件名称。接下来,我们来介绍一些常用的选项:
- -l:列出压缩文件中的内容,但不解压缩文件
- -d 目标目录:将文件解压缩到指定的目标目录
- -q:安静模式,不显示任何解压缩过程中的信息
- -f:覆盖已存在的文件
- -o:不提示,直接覆盖原文件
通过这些选项,我们可以根据具体的需求来选择不同的操作方式。接下来,我们来看一些示例:
1. 列出压缩文件中的内容:
```
unzip -l test.zip
```
通过这个命令,我们可以快速查看test.zip中包含的所有文件和文件夹。
2. 解压缩文件到指定目录:
```
unzip -d /home/user/test test.zip
```
通过这个命令,我们可以将test.zip中的文件解压缩到/home/user/test目录下。
3. 安静模式解压缩文件:
```
unzip -q test.zip
```
通过这个命令,我们可以在解压缩文件的过程中不显示任何信息。
4. 覆盖已存在文件:
```
unzip -f test.zip
```
通过这个命令,我们可以在解压缩文件时覆盖已经存在的文件。
5. 不提示,直接覆盖原文件:
```
unzip -o test.zip
```
通过这个命令,我们可以在解压缩文件时不提示,直接覆盖原文件。
总的来说,unzip命令是一个非常强大且灵活的解压缩工具,在Linux系统中被广泛使用。通过掌握unzip命令的基本用法和一些常用选项,我们可以更高效地处理各种类型的压缩文件。希望本文对读者有所帮助,可以更好地理解并使用Linux系统中的unzip命令。